This is a normal post It was an example of how to do arcs well.
JMS apparently laid out the plot from beginning to end first, rather than seemingly making it up as he went as writers often do these days.

This is a normal post It was excellent for the time and budget. One of the best science fiction series ever.
The incidental music is mostly unobtrusive... It's marmite, I've never been enthusiastic about it, but I've met fans who absolutely love it and seek out every CD. I never paid much attention to it at the time. The main theme is fine, the establishing shot stings are good, the rest is quite unmemorable.

As others have said, S1 is slow (and a bit stiff in a militaristic way), 2, 3 and 4 are great, 5 is not so good (the network cancelled season 5 forcing the writer to compress everything into season 4, then they were so impressed with season 4 that they uncancelled season 5, but there were only subplots left to tie up by that point).

The aborted 'Excalibur' spinoff is not quite as bad as Lexx. It's interesting to watch as you can practically see the executive interference ruining the show in real time. The various straight to video movies are okay, but not essential viewing.
